The ECCT launched its annual "Monitoring the Implementation of Taiwan's WTO Commitments" report in January 2001. Last month, the ECCT had its first meeting with the Board of Foreign Trade. The ECCT will now meet with the board twice a month to discuss the areas of WTO where Taiwan is not yet compliant, Inman said yesterday.
